What are the facilities at Meriton Suites Bondi Junction?

In-suite amenities

  • Each suite includes a full kitchen, washer/dryer, and separate living area (Meriton Suites official site).
  • Many suites provide harbour views – the higher the floor, the better the panorama (Booking.com).
  • Free unlimited Wi-Fi is included in every room (Meriton Suites official site).

Building facilities

  • Two indoor swimming pools and two hot tubs are available (Expedia).
  • Fitness centre, sauna, and steam room complement the pool area (Hotels.com Australia).
  • Car parking at A$45 per night, subject to availability (Meriton Suites official site).
  • Luggage storage and 24-hour front desk are on site.

The pattern: This is less a hotel and more a self-contained apartment block with resort extras. For families or longer stays, the kitchen and laundry are game-changers. For a weekend splurge, the pools and views deliver.

Is Meriton Suites a 5 star hotel?

Official star rating vs guest perception

  • Meriton Suites Bondi Junction does not display an official star rating from AAA or similar accreditation bodies – neither on its website nor on major booking platforms like Expedia and Hotels.com.
  • On TripAdvisor, it averages 4.5 out of 5 from over 1,200 reviews (TripAdvisor).
  • Booking.com rates it 8.5/10 and labels it “luxury” – but not officially 5-star (Booking.com).

What the 5-star classification usually means

  • True 5-star hotels in Australia (e.g., Park Hyatt, Four Seasons) offer concierge, room service, and a full-service restaurant – none of which Meriton Suites provides.
  • Meriton focuses on self-sufficient suites rather than luxury service, making it more of a high-end aparthotel than a traditional 5-star.

Why this matters: If you expect butler service and a doorman, this isn’t that. If you want space, a kitchen, and a pool that actually works for laps, the lack of a star badge won’t bother you.

Frequently asked questions

Does Meriton Suites Bondi Junction have a swimming pool?

Yes, there are two indoor swimming pools, along with two hot tubs, a sauna, and a steam room. Pool hours are 5:00 AM to 10:00 PM (Hotels.com Australia).

Is breakfast included in the room rate?

No, Meriton Suites is an aparthotel with no on-site restaurant. Each suite has a full kitchen, so you can prepare your own meals. Some packages may include breakfast vouchers – check at booking.
